      Meaning of the first name
      Vivion

      Origin 
      English; Derived from Latin

      Meaning 
      Alive or Lively

      Variations 
      Vivian, Vivien, Vision

      The name Vivion originates from the English language, which is derived from the Latin root vivus, meaning alive or lively. The name is often associated with vibrant energy and spiritedness, embodying the essence of life itself. The construction of the name suggests a lively character and has historically been bestowed upon individuals to evoke a sense of vitality and enthusiasm.

      Historically, Vivion has been used as both a given name and a surname, with variations appearing in different cultures over time. Its roots can be traced back to medieval Latin, where names connoting vitality and life were common. The name gained recognition in the English-speaking world during the 19th and 20th centuries as naming conventions began to evolve and embrace more distinctive and meaningful titles. Through the ages, figures bearing the name Vivion, whether in literature, politics, or arts, have contributed to its legacy, reinforcing the positive connotations associated with it.

      In contemporary society, the name Vivion remains relatively uncommon but has seen a revival due to its unique sound and positive meaning. It appeals to parents seeking names that reflect lively and vibrant qualities for their children. Additionally, it has begun to appear in various pop culture references, from literature to digital media, further embedding it in modern nomenclature. As a result, the name Vivion continues to resonate with those who appreciate names that carry historical significance and a spirited essence.
